What Exactly Is Vanity Replacement?
Vanity replacement involves completely removing your old bathroom vanity — encompassing the cabinet unit, sink deck, sink basin, and associated plumbing fixtures — and mounting an entirely fresh assembly in its place. This distinguishes a simple resurfacing project, where purely the outer coating is updated.
What's involved of a vanity replacement can range significantly depending on the existing plumbing configuration. Some projects go smoothly — trading a common-dimension vanity in the same footprint. Different situations require rerouting water supply connections, cutting into wall surfaces, or repairing the structural base beneath the cabinet.

The Vanity Replacement Process Step by Step
-
Initial Consultation and Measurement
A Brother & Brother Builders specialist comes to your home to assess the existing vanity configuration. Careful measurements are taken of the footprint, note drain and supply line placement, and discuss your preferences for the replacement vanity.
-
Design Finalization and Ordering
Based on your budget and goals, we help you select the best-fitting unit — along with sink and hardware options. Popular choices include granite, ceramic, and cultured marble. Components are sourced and checked for accuracy.
-
Shutoff and Demolition
The shutoff valves are turned off before any work begins. The existing faucet comes out first, followed by the sink and top surface. The cabinet base is taken out to avoid damaging the nearby flooring.
-
Wall and Plumbing Preparation
With the old vanity out, our crew inspects the area behind the vanity for moisture damage. Remediation work are handled at this stage before new materials are installed. Drain lines are repositioned if necessary to match the incoming vanity.
-
Vanity Cabinet Installation
The incoming unit is set in place correctly aligned against the wall. Fasteners connect it to solid backing to ensure stability for long-term performance. Shims and leveling feet are used wherever the floor is uneven.
-
Top Surface and Fixture Connection
The sink deck is placed and sealed along the back edge to create a watertight seal. Your chosen sink style is fitted and locked in place. Replacement fixtures are connected to the supply lines and checked for leaks.
-
Final Inspection and Cleanup
Each fitting gets checked for correct installation. Flow testing is performed through the full system and verifies clears properly. The work area is tidied up before we consider the job done.

Vanity Replacement Frequently Asked Questions
How long does a vanity replacement usually last from start to finish?
The typical job is completed in one to two days depending on whether wall repairs are required. Jobs involving custom countertop fabrication sometimes take two to three days to reach final inspection.
What does vanity replacement cost in San Jose?
What you'll spend varies based on a few variables: cabinet style, countertop selection, and plumbing conditions. Most homeowners in the area budget roughly $900 to $3,800 for a fully finished vanity replacement. Custom or high-end configurations sometimes exceed those ranges.
Is vanity replacement hard on the household?
It's far less disruptive than most clients anticipate. The bathroom will be unusable for a portion of the day during the project. We takes precautions to shield your nearby tile and walls from tool marks.
How long do vanity replacement results stay looking good?
Quality cabinetry and countertops can easily last two decades or more with regular cleaning and basic maintenance. Plumbing components could require servicing sooner, though the main unit can remain in excellent shape long-term.
